Infinite systems of first order PFDEs with mixed conditions

W. Czernous (2008)

Annales Polonici Mathematici

We consider mixed problems for infinite systems of first order partial functional differential equations. An infinite number of deviating functions is permitted, and the delay of an argument may also depend on the spatial variable. A theorem on the existence of a solution and its continuous dependence upon initial boundary data is proved. The method of successive approximations is used in the existence proof. Initial boundary value problem for generalized Zakharov equations

Shujun You, Boling Guo, Xiaoqi Ning (2012)

Applications of Mathematics

This paper considers the existence and uniqueness of the solution to the initial boundary value problem for a class of generalized Zakharov equations in ( 2 + 1 ) dimensions, and proves the global existence of the solution to the problem by a priori integral estimates and the Galerkin method.

Initial boundary value problems of the Degasperis-Procesi equation

Joachim Escher, Zhaoyang Yin (2008)

Banach Center Publications

We mainly study initial boundary value problems for the Degasperis-Procesi equation on the half line and on a compact interval. By the symmetry of the equation, we can convert these boundary value problems into Cauchy problems on the line and on the circle, respectively. Applying thus known results for the equation on the line and on the circle, we first obtain the local well-posedness of the initial boundary value problems.
